Panwariya

Panwariya is a village located in Nateran tehsil of Vidisha district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Nateran (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Vidisha. As per 2009 stats, Pamaria is the gram panchayat of Panwariya village.

About Panwariya

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Panwariya is 481440. The village spans a total geographical area of 1194.2 hectares. Vidisha is nearest town to Panwariya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 48km away.

Population of Panwariya

According to the 2011 Census, Panwariya has a total population of about 2,025, with approximately 1,063 males and 962 females. The sex ratio is around 904 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 351 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 659 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 60.05%, with male literacy at about 67.54% and female literacy near 51.77%. There are around 427 households in the village. Connectivity of Panwariya

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Panwariya. As per the 2011 stats, Panwariya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
